
Vienna International Airport Faces Extensive Flight Delays and Cancellations
Vienna International Airport encountered considerable operational challenges on June 25, 2026, with more than one hundred flights delayed and several cancelled. Specifically, 117 flights experienced delays while six flights were cancelled, causing disruptions for travelers departing on that day.
These disruptions affected multiple carriers operating from the airport, including Eurowings, Finnair, Lauda Europe, and Austrian Airlines. Passengers traveling from Vienna to several major German cities such as Berlin, Stuttgart, Frankfurt, Hamburg, Düsseldorf, and Munich were impacted by these delays and cancellations.
